According to sources, the pilot reached for handles that could have shut down the plane's engines—handles that are designed to be accessed only by authorized personnel. His actions led to a physical struggle, with crew members and passengers intervening. The man was eventually subdued, restrained with zip ties, and taken to the back of the aircraft. Evidence suggests he was attempting to activate the plane’s engine fire suppression system, which would have resulted in shutting down the engines at cruising altitude—a potentially catastrophic move.
